首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Javascript数字游戏不显示输出

JavaScript数字游戏不显示输出可能是由以下几个原因引起的:

  1. 代码逻辑错误:检查代码中是否存在语法错误、逻辑错误或者变量命名错误等问题。确保代码正确地计算和显示输出结果。
  2. 控制台输出问题:如果代码中使用了console.log()来输出结果,但是控制台没有显示任何输出,可能是因为控制台被关闭或者代码中存在其他错误导致程序没有执行到console.log()语句。可以尝试打开控制台查看是否有错误提示,并检查代码的执行流程。
  3. 页面元素显示问题:如果代码中使用了DOM操作来显示输出结果,但是页面上没有显示任何内容,可能是因为代码中存在错误导致元素没有正确地被创建或者显示。可以检查代码中的DOM操作逻辑,确保元素正确地被创建和显示。
  4. 浏览器兼容性问题:不同的浏览器对JavaScript的支持程度有所不同,可能会导致代码在某些浏览器上无法正常执行或者显示输出结果。可以尝试在不同的浏览器上测试代码,或者使用浏览器兼容性工具来解决兼容性问题。

总结起来,解决JavaScript数字游戏不显示输出的问题需要仔细检查代码逻辑、控制台输出、页面元素显示以及浏览器兼容性等方面的问题,并逐一排查和修复。如果问题仍然存在,可以提供更具体的代码和错误信息,以便更好地帮助解决问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 【Java探索之旅】从输入输出到猜数字游戏

    文章目录 前言 一、输入输出 1.1 输出到控制台 1.2 从键盘输入 二、猜数字游戏 2.1 所需知识: 2.2 游戏规则: 2.3 完整代码 2.4 代码解析 ️全篇总结 前言 本文将介绍如何在Java...中进行控制台的输入输出操作,并通过一个简单的猜数字游戏示例来展示分支语句、循环语句的运用。...生成要猜测的数字: 使用random.nextInt(100)生成一个0到99(包含0,包含100)之间的随机整数。...如果用户输入的数字等于要猜测的数字输出“猜对了”并退出循环。 关闭Scanner: 在游戏结束后,关闭Scanner对象,释放与之关联的资源。 ️...全篇总结 看到这里,你学已经会了如何在Java中进行简单的输入输出操作,包括输出到控制台和从键盘输入。同时,通过一个有趣的猜数字游戏示例,你也了解了如何运用分支语句和循环语句来实现一个小游戏

    13110

    IT课程 HTML基础 015_HTML5新特性

    这意味着 SVG 图形可以以任意大小显示,而不会失去质量。SVG 图形还可以使用 CSS 和 JavaScript 进行操作和动画化。...JavaScript 进行操作和动画化的图形 Canvas 适用于场景: 需要创建复杂图形的场景,例如游戏、动画 需要使用 JavaScript 进行复杂操作的场景 HTML5表单 HTML5 引入了一些新的输入类型和属性...placeholder 提供对输入字段的简短提示,仅在字段为空时显示。 required 指定输入字段是否为必填字段。 step 指定 元素的合法数字间隔。...推荐 定义不同类型的输出,比如脚本的输出。 推荐 定义页面独立的内容区域。 推荐 定义页面的侧边栏内容。...建议使用JavaScript 来判断浏览器是否支持框架,并根据情况显示或隐藏内容。 推荐 设置文本的删除线。 建议使用CSS 来设置文本样式。

    9610

    JavaScript入门基础

    Js) 桌面程序 (Electron) App (Cordova) 控制硬件-物联网 (Ruff) 游戏开发 (cocos 2 d-js) 浏览器执行 JavaScript 简介 浏览器分成两部分:渲染引擎和...document.write(): 页面上文档显示 console.log(msg): 浏览器控制台打印输出信息 prompt(info): 浏览器弹出输入框,用户可以输入 变量 变量在使用时分为两步...Log (age); 只声明赋值 undefined console.Log (age) 声明赋值直接使用 报错 age = 10; console....但是下面这种做法就是错误的,他们的地址其实不一样: 考虑修改为: 变量命名规范 由字母 (A-Za-z)、数字 (0-9)、下划线 (_)、美元符号 ( $ )组成,如:usrAge,...Var app; 和 var App; 是两个变量 不能以数字开头。 18 age 是错误的 不能是关键字、保留字。例如:var、for、while 遵守驼峰命名法。

    21330

    【海贼王航海日志:前端技术探索】一篇文章带你走进JavaScript(一)

    JavaScript能做的事情: 网页开发(更复杂的特效和用户交互)。 网页游戏开发。 服务器开发(node.js)。 桌面程序开发(Electron,VSCode就是这么来的)。 手机APP开发。...// 弹出一个输入框 prompt("请输入您的姓名:"); 2.3.2 -> 输出 输出:alert 弹出一个警示对话框,输出结果。...阎王·三刀龙·一百三情·飞龙侍极 代码示例:弹框提示用户输入信息,再弹框显示。 test.html 基本数据类型 4.1 -> 内置类型 JS中内置的几种类型: number:数字区分整数和小数。 boolean:true真,false假。 string:字符串类型。...4.2 -> number数字类型 JS中区分整数和浮点数,统一都使用"数字类型"来表示。 数字进制表示 计算机中都是使用二进制来表示数据,而人平时都是使用十进制。

    8510

    Javascript 变量 ,数据类型,运算符

    基于对象 内置大量现成对象,编写少量程序可以完成目标 2、js使用范围 客户端数据计算 客户端表单合法性验证 浏览器对象的调用 浏览器事件的触发 网页特殊显示效果制作 3、Javascript 与html...所以推荐大家将能合并的js文件合并到一个文件中,然后再去引用 5、JavaScript 输出消息的几个写法 alert(“”);在页面中弹出提示框,显示消息 confirm(“”) ;弹窗显示...("");在控制台输出消息,一般用来调试程序 编写Javascript注意语法规范,一行代码结束后必须在代码最后加上英文输入法下的 ;(逗号) 6、认识Javascript中变量 声明变量(定义变量...变量可以包含数字、从A至Z的大小字母(不能使用纯数字) 4. 推荐使用汉字定义变量 5. JavaScript严格区分大小写,computer和Computer是两个完全不同的变量 6....7、数据类型介绍 1、简单数据类型 Number(数字):所有的数字(整数,负数,小数) 1、最基本的数据类型 2、区分整型数值和浮点型数值 3、能表示的最大值是±1.7976931348623157

    1.4K30

    JavaScript基本语法:从入门到精通

    数据请求通过AJAX(Asynchronous JavaScript and XML)技术,JavaScript可以在刷新整个页面的情况下向服务器请求数据,实现无缝的数据加载。c....游戏开发许多在线游戏和网页游戏都使用JavaScript来创建游戏逻辑和互动元素。d....常见的数据类型包括:字符串(String)数字(Number)布尔(Boolean)数组(Array)对象(Object)空值(null)未定义(undefined)let name = "John";...// 字符串let age = 30; // 数字let isStudent = true; // 布尔let colors = ["red", "green", "blue"...;}greet("John"); // 调用函数并输出 "Hello, John!"函数使得代码可维护性更强,也更易于重用。h. 数组数组是一种数据结构,用于存储多个值。

    50766

    手把手教你使用JavaScript打造一款扫雷游戏

    扫雷大家都玩过,今天我们就是用JavaScript来打造扫雷游戏。废话不多说,直接看下效果; 上图是失败后的结果。...一、思路分析 我们新建一个首页,在首页放置一个点击开始游戏的按钮,动态生成100个小格,即100div;然后通过点击div进行扫雷操作,然后扫雷成功或者失败显示对应的结果; 二、静态页面搭建 2.1 结构层...-- 游戏结束才显示的当前雷数的div--> 当前剩余雷数: 10 ...box.innerHTML = ''; startGameBool = true; } } 3.4 核心事件函数封装 leftClick 没有雷 --> 显示数字...} } 3.5 游戏开始 bindEvent() 四、总结 本文我们通过JavaScript打造了简单的扫雷游戏,首先是设计下简单的界面样式,然后通过扫雷的逻辑动态构建雷块的位置,通过点击小方块进行扫雷

    62120

    游戏实战-Python实现石头剪刀布+扫雷小游戏

    实现思路用户从键盘获取输入数字,1:石头、2:剪刀、3:布;计算机保存1:石头、2:剪刀、3:布存入一个列表,并随机取值;用户先输入,然后计算机随机出数字,比对结果即可。...运行效果扫雷-内网摸鱼必备游戏游戏规则主要是进行打印输出输出显示游戏区域;显示整个游戏区域,包含是雷和包含雷的区域。...实现思路打印游戏区域;创建雷;计算非雷格的邻居雷数;显示安全格子(即包含雷的格子);组织游戏打印输出。...运行效果进阶练习-走迷宫(预留)我们预留一个小作业,感兴趣的可以玩玩,游戏说明如下:游戏规则打印输出一个迷宫,字母C表示人,通过输入a,d,w,s键来控制闯迷宫的左右上下方向;当人C遇到墙时,不能进行前行...文中的小游戏其实网上也有很多的版本,建议学习的时候可以自行发挥,还有很多可以进行优化的地方,比如石头剪刀布的非指定数字的判断、扫雷游戏的互动(可以增加和电脑的互动),有兴趣的也可以看看预留的一个作业走迷宫

    26521

    实战|仅用18行JavaScript构建一个倒数计时器

    有时候,你会需要构建一个 JavaScript 倒计时时钟。你可能会有一个活动、一个销售、一个促销或一个游戏。你可以用原生的 JavaScript 构建一个时钟,而不是去找一个插件。...将时钟数据输出为可重复使用的对象。 在页面上显示时钟,并在时钟为零时停止时钟。 2.设置有效的结束日期 首先,你需要设置一个有效的结束日期。...现在,你仅用 18 行 JavaScript 就拥有了一个基本时钟。 7.准备展示你的时钟 在设置时钟样式之前,我们需要进行一些改进。 消除初始延迟,使你的时钟立即显示。...例如,不是让时钟显示 7 秒,而是显示 07 秒。一种简单的方法是在一个数的开头加上一串“0”,然后切掉最后两个数字。...例如,我们可能有一系列事件即将发生,而希望每次都手动更新时钟。以下是如何提前安排事情的方法。

    4.2K41

    python实现数字炸弹游戏程序

    相信许多小伙伴都玩过数字炸弹游戏,就是指在一定数字范围(一般是整数,包含边界)里,一个玩家选中一个数字当作炸弹,其余玩家在这个范围猜数字,每次只要没猜中炸弹数字,则根据玩家猜的数字缩小范围,直至其中一个玩家猜中炸弹数字...,游戏结束。...在这里,我们可以尝试用Python编程的思想来拆解游戏过程(纯属无聊),核心主要为以下两个问题: (1)数字炸弹的产生 (2)如何缩小范围 第一个问题很简单,可以使用random模块随机生成,需要注意的是数字炸弹不包含边界...本人是采用循环的方法,将生成的不符合要求的数字炸弹过滤掉;第二个问题是更为核心的问题,不断缩小范围,我们容易想到用while循环,最后猜中数字break跳出循环,游戏结束。...更多有趣的经典小游戏实现专题,分享给大家: C++经典小游戏汇总 python经典小游戏汇总 python俄罗斯方块游戏集合 JavaScript经典游戏 玩不停 java经典小游戏汇总 javascript

    98910

    一起来玩玩WebGL

    显然,WebGL技术标准免去了开发网页专用渲染插件的麻烦,可被用于创建具有复杂3D结构的网站页面,甚至可以用来设计3D网页游戏等等。 乍一看上面的描述,JavaScript谁不会啊?...对于输出的结果显示,基本上都是文字字母,简单的在阴极射线管显示器即可显示。...对CPU的操作和对输出结果的显示,这一切都是操作系统和编译器完成的事情,简单的说,编译器把高级语言编译成了01指令,而操作系统则是把底层硬件管理给封装成了系统接口调用,我们只需要调用系统接口就可以了,所以我们调用一下...这样就可以把一个图形给量化成数字,既然已经是数字化了,就可以给计算机处理了。现在我们就能理解到,实际上一张二维的图片,就是一个二维整形矩阵,这些都是我们在CPU和内存都可以操作的逻辑了。...NO.5 总结 这一弹就先学习这么多了,主要以介绍和理解WebGL为主,暂时上手写代码,即使上面有一些例子代码,主要还是以阅读理解为主,先感受感受这个历史进程,培养一下兴趣,一步一个脚印,慢慢学习,目前先重点学习了一下着色器

    1.1K41

    JavaScript笔记(1)

    本文由“壹伴编辑器”提供技术支持 JavaScript的作用: 表单动态验证(js产生的最初目的) 网页特效 服务端开发(Node.js) 桌面程序 APP 控制硬件-物联网 游戏开发 本文由“壹伴编辑器...本文由“壹伴编辑器”提供技术支持 JS注释 单行注释:// 快捷键:Ctrl+/ 多行注释:/* */ 快捷键:Shift+Alt+A 本文由“壹伴编辑器”提供技术支持 JavaScript输入输出语句...undefined console.log(age) 声明,赋值,直接使用 报错 age=10;console.log(age) 声明,只赋值 10 变量的数据类型 变量是用来存储值的所在处...现阶段我们只需要记住:在JS中,八进制的前面是0,十六进制的前面是0x isNaN() 用来判断一个变量是否为非数字的类型,返回true(非数字)或false(数字)....; alert(strMsg.length); // 显示 11 布尔值 布尔类型有两个值:true 和 false ,其中 true 表示真(对),而 false 表示假(错)。

    61110

    Web前端学习 第3章 JavaScript基础教程9 内置对象

    需要说明的是document对象是DOM提供的对象,不属于JavaScript内置对象,window对象是BOM中的对象,同样不属于JavaScript内置对象。...例如我们想要1~10的随机数,代码如下 1 var number = Math.floor(Math.random()*10 + 1); 2 console.log(number); 下面我们来实现一个猜数字游戏...,JavaScript随机生成一个1~100之间的数字,我们通过文本输入框输入我们所猜的数字,猜的数字不管是大于结果,还是小于结果,还是等于结果,都会有相应的提示 代码如下 1 <input type...h1标签中,但是我们显示的时间是获取的那个时间点,显示的时间是静止不动的,我们可以通过计时器方法让我们显示的时间与实际时间同步 1 var h1 = document.querySelector("h1...在控制台输出这个时间。

    50350
    领券